Fisher & Paykel IWL16 Washer Cycle Issue

4 years ago

At start-up the washer fills to the appropriate level but when the water cuts off and the agitator starts water is immediately being pumped through the recirculating hose back into the tub. And because the tub is floating as it should be, water is not free flowing back into the tub as it's obstructed by the washer tub ring so a fair amount is being deflected back and over the outside of the tub and thus on the floor. I'm at a loss as to if/how this can be fixed or if it's a control board failure that requires replacement.

    The pump shouldn't run for recirculation at all if the water in the tub is higher than the very low recirculation level.

    Does it run normal recirculation before agitation begins?

    Have you tried setting the Traditional Wash option so Eco Active recirculation doesn't occur? Does the pump then still run when agitation begins?

    Not necessary to have clothes in for testing the levels. Each level fills to slightly below the respective mark on the agitator, those marks are the level of dry fabric suitable for the level, not the level of the water. Run a "normal" cycle with Traditional Wash selected and the lowest load size. Pause the cycle when agitation begins, increase the level, and Start to resume. It should fill to the new level and continue agitation. Check each level in turn to see if any of them fill higher or if none of them do so. There should be no recirculation at any point with Traditional Wash selected ... although my reference for that is model IWL12 which is a Phase 6 unit. IWL16 is a Phase 7 so could possibly act different in that respect, but I don't think it should.

    You could also try the Handwash fabric choice (and manual water level selection for testing) which runs a Traditional Wash without needing to specifically select that option.

    Sounds as if the pressure sensor on the motor board is bad ... or maybe the pressure tube is leaking air pressure, or the air dome integral to the outer tub where the tube attaches is clogged .... either of which can cause a false reading on the level.

    There are some other tests you can do if you want go further into the diagnostics, including getting numbers on what the pressure sensor is reading.

    Ran Traditional Wash as instructed. There was no recirculation at any point. However, I could not go through all the water levels as the tub would have over flowed. Specifically, the low level setting filled to medium on the agitator, medium low filled to med high, medium filled to high, med high to tub top so couldn't run high fill.


    l did check the air dome integral and it was clear. Also had examined the pressure tube for any obvious damage but didn't see anything, realizing that a cursory visual doesn't guarantee much.


    If I start a new Eco cycle and manually set the water level the tub only fills to the low mark on the agitator regardless of the water level manually selected.

    Sorry, long reply ...

    Check if the machine size is wrong, although it shouldn't be unless someone accidentally accessed that procedure and changed it. F&P machines on other world markets are sold in three capacity sizes. U.S. models are all the largest size but the board must still be set for it.

    - With Power off, press and hold Fabric Care, then press Power at the same time. Four beeps and the display shows choices. Power off and try again if necessary. The setting should be at 650mm (L). Press Option to toggle/select the correct choice if necessary, then Power to exit and save, or Power to exit if it doesn't need changing.

    Next, check the reading on the pressure sensor with the tub empty.

    - With Power off, Press and hold Lifecycle, then press Power at the same time. Two beeps, the display lit but blank (or maybe not blank, doesn't matter). Press/hold Lifecycle again a few seconds for a 2nd beep, release it. Press it once more if the display is blank, or not if it isn't blank. There are several screens of information. Press Option Up or Down until the display says "Not in Sense." The middle parameter on the bottom line should be WL:x where x is 0 or 1 or 2 or some such low number. It's a reference to the tub water level

    Power to exit Diagnostics.

    Then check the pressure reading again with water in the tub at Low (Traditional Wash to avoid Eco Active). Turn the machine off when agitation begins. Get into Diagnostic as above, check the WL:x reading. My IWL12 reads 67-68 for Low. Medium level in the tub (about an inch below top of the Med agitator mark) reads 125. There may be some minor variation from one machine to another for a given level.

    If your Low fills to Medium in the tub but reads a figure for Low then the pressure sensor on the motor board apparently is wonky and the board needs replacement.

    If the reading is reasonable for Low but the pump for recirculation (with the diverter valve energized) then something is still apparently wonky with the board.

    Capacity is correct. W values are zero when empty, 48-49 at low, 179-180 at medium when fill stopped. The water is still in the tub and the level reading has dropped to 175 over the last 15 minutes. Is there some spec for holding a reading?

    It shouldn't reasonably change at all. Monitor if it continues to drop. The level reading dropping without an accompanying change in the actual tub level indicates the pressure tube (or the sensor on the board) has a pressure leak. Check if there's an obvious pinhole or crack in the tube (can be difficult to locate). Can also cut a smiden off the ends for a fresh/tighter fit on the tub and board connections if either/both seems insecure. May or may not fix the problem. Else replace the board. There are used boards sometimes on eBay if you're inclined to go that route. Be sure to look up the part number on parts sources / diagrams, it may substitute to an updated number. Either way it must be a legitimate Phase 7 board. Some Phase 7 boards are reflashed to Phase 6 firmware and the part number relabeled.

    One last question.. I cleared an obstruction from the diverter valve last week but didn't mark the 2 connectors. Does it matter which terminals they connect to or are they interchangeable?

  • 4 years ago

    No. Both wires are the same color (orange), yes? The connector(s) would be keyed to fit one way if orientation is of consequence.

    You can test the diverter for proper operation via diagnostic mode.

    - Access Diagnostics. Bring up the Machine Status screen. The top line references Diverter:Off/Heating/On/Cooling/Off per the status. Press Home to turn on the diverter to get it ready (Heating --> On). Press/hold How Dirty Down to run in some cold water, up to Low level or whatever. (How Dirty Up runs hot water.) When the diverter is ready (On), press Fabric Care to turn on the pump. Water should recirculate. Press Home to turn the diverter off (Cooling --> Off). Water flow should switch away from recirculation toward drain as it cools and shifts position. Press Fabric Care to turn the pump off when all the water is drained. Power to exit.

    Follow-up in case this helps someone else. Ordered the board from PartSimple/Corecentric and it arrived yesterday. Installed and tested as done on previous board. Worked as intended so ran a small load. No issues! Hopefully we'll get some good mileage out of the board/washer. Thank you again dadoes!
